Simplified Elastic-Plastic Analysis of Stiffened Plates and Space Frames

1988 
In this paper two algorithms are presented for approximate nonlinear analysis of stiffened plates subjected to lateral and/or in-plane loads. The stiffened plate is treated either as an equivalent orthotropic plate or as a space frame. The last case corresponds to a discrete beam idealization in which the plate is represented by effective flanges acting together with the stiffeners according to simple beam theory. For plane cases local buckling phenomena are incorporated into the frame model.Three points are believed to be new in this paper:—comparisons between the two models in nonlinear range are made and as a conclusion the necessity of application of both models of real structure is confirmed because of very different results obtained in elastic and elastic-plastic range.—the additivity of elastic and plastic parts of the total generalized displacement is discussed and some error estimates in terms of known Timoshenko beam hypothesis are given,—formulas for modification of effective breadth values tre...
